Expert Insights
From a fundamental valuation perspective, Cramer’s commentary underscores a critical mispricing in the semiconductor sector that has persisted as investors overconcentrated on NVIDIA’s GPU dominance. While NVDA retains an estimated 82% of the global AI accelerator market as of Q1 2026, per IDC data, the agentic AI segment is projected to grow at a 78% compound annual growth rate (CAGR) through 2030, and CPU requirements for these workloads are expected to account for 32% of total AI semiconductor spend by 2029, up from just 11% in 2025. This creates a $127 billion addressable market that NVIDIA is largely locked out of in the near term, as the firm’s custom Arm-based Grace CPUs hold less than 3% of the data center CPU market and are not compatible with the majority of legacy x86-based agentic AI software stacks currently in enterprise deployment. For investors, the relative valuation discrepancy between NVDA and its CPU-focused peers presents asymmetric upside opportunities. AMD’s EPYC server CPU line has already captured 34% of the data center CPU market as of Q1 2026, up 8 percentage points year-over-year, with management guiding for 52% growth in AI-optimized CPU revenue in 2026. Intel, meanwhile, is expected to launch its 14th generation Xeon CPU line in Q3 2026, which is projected to deliver 40% higher performance on agentic AI workloads than current generation chips, putting it in position to recapture lost market share. That said, investors should exercise appropriate caution. While Cramer’s endorsement has historically driven short-term price spikes for named equities, with an average 3.2% one-day gain for small- and mid-cap stocks mentioned on Mad Money per a 2025 University of Chicago study, long-term returns depend on consistent execution of product roadmaps and ability to meet growing AI demand. It is also important to note that NVIDIA is not standing still in the CPU space: the firm’s ongoing $12 billion annual R&D investment in Arm-based data center CPUs could allow it to capture a portion of the agentic AI compute market over the long term, though compatibility barriers and market penetration timelines remain uncertain, creating a balanced risk profile for all players.
